XpCancelJob(3Xp)	       XPRINT FUNCTIONS		     XpCancelJob(3Xp)



NAME
       XpCancelJob -  Cancels a single print job.

SYNOPSIS
	     cc [ flag... ] file... -lXp [ library... ]
	     #include <X11/extensions/Print.h>

       void XpCancelJob ( display, discard )
	     Display *display;
	     Bool discard;


ARGUMENTS
       display
	      Specifies	 a  pointer  to	 the Display structure; returned from
	      XOpenDisplay.

       discard
	      When TRUE, specifies that all XPPrintNotify  events  should  be
	      discarded.

DESCRIPTION
       XpCancelJob  cancels  an	 in-progress job. If the job was started with
       output_mode XPGetData then the data  stream  to	XpGetDocumentData  is
       terminated.  For many page description languages such arbitrary termi-
       nation may invalidate the output.

       If the job was started with output_mode XPSpool then depending on  the
       driver  and  spooler configuration the entire job may be canceled or a
       partial job may be generated.

       If discard is TRUE, all XPPrintNotify events with a  detail  field  of
       XPEndPageNotify,	  XPEndDocNotify,  or  XPEndJobNotify  are  discarded
       before XpCancelJob returns.

       For clients  selecting  XPPrintMask  (see  XpSelectInput),  the	event
       XPPrintNotify will be generated with its detail field set to XPEndJob-
       Notify.

DIAGNOSTICS
       XPBadContext   A valid print context-id has not been set prior to mak-
		      ing this call.

       XPBadSequence  The  function  was  not called in the proper order with
		      respect to the other X Print  Service  Extension	calls
		      (for example, XpEndJob prior to XpStartJob).
